Smith to host Music Bingo fundraiser for State House District 96 Campaign
Lisa Smith, a candidate for State House District 96, is set to host a Music Bingo Fundraiser on Wednesday, March 6. The event will take place at the Oren L. Davis VFW Post 99, located at 3920 N Martin Luther King Jr Dr. in Decatur. Promising an evening of musical enjoyment and entertainment, the event offers attendees the chance to express their support for Smith, who identifies herself as the "Freedom candidate."

Smith, candidate for state representative HD 96: 'Illinois’ economy and our workers continue to suffer under the mismanaged economy of Sue Scherer'
The COVID-19 pandemic had a nationwide impact on many economic sectors and states are now in the process of recovery. With the third highest unemployment rate in the nation, Illinois’ economy is lagging behind other states compared to the national average. It is the belief of many Republican elected officials and candidates that current policies of high taxes and rigid regulations is the cause.
